The oil refinery in Tuapse suspended its operations after the arrival of the UAV, which reduced Rosneft’s production by 10%.
After the attack of Ukrainian drones on the plant Rosneft in Tuapse, held on January 25, oil production there decreased by 10%. Overall, Russian oil refineries cut production by 4% last month compared to January last year. This was said by a pro-government Russian newspaper Kommersant with reference to own sources.

Let’s add that it was previously predicted that as a result of attacks by Ukrainian drones on Russian refineries and oil depots in the Black and Baltic seas and deep in the rear, Russia will reduce the export of petroleum products by 127.5 -136 thousand barrels per day, which is a third of its exports.
